    for ease of reference and ordering, here is the required amount of LEDs for each aspect of the cluster:
    - Tach = 2
    - Tach Needle = 2
    - Speedo = 3
    - Speedo Needle = 3
    - Temp = 1
    - Temp Needle = 1
    - Fuel = 1
    - Fuel Needle = 1
    - Odometer = 3
    - Turn Signals = 2 per side
    - Additional indicators (ie CEL, Batt, Cruise etc..) = 1 per light
